What Is a Jaw Crusher Used For?

Jaw crushers are the workhorses of the crushing world—rugged machines designed to break down tough materials into manageable pieces. Whether you’re dealing with stone, ore, or concrete, jaw crushers are often the first step in turning raw material into usable product. But what exactly are they used for? Here’s a closer look at their most common applications.


Primary Crushing of Hard Materials

Jaw crushers are most commonly used for primary crushing—the first step in the size reduction process. They handle large, unprocessed materials with ease.

Preparing Aggregates for Construction

In road building and concrete production, aggregate size and shape matter. Jaw crushers help prepare high-quality aggregates for these purposes.

Why Jaw Crushers Are Used:

  • Break down larger stones into construction-grade material4
  • Produce well-graded output for concrete, asphalt, and road base
  • Often paired with screens and secondary crushers for final shape
Ứng dụng Material Size Required Jaw Crusher Role
Road base 20–60 mm Coarse initial reduction
Concrete mixing 10–20 mm Consistent particle sizing
Asphalt aggregate 5–10 mm Prepares feed for fine crushing

From highways to high-rises, jaw crushers make sure the foundation materials are strong and consistent5.

Mineral Processing and Ore Reduction

In mining, jaw crushers are essential for breaking down ores into manageable sizes for further processing, whether by grinding, flotation, or chemical separation.

Recycling Demolition Waste

Jaw crushers are also central to the recycling industry, especially in construction and demolition (C&D) waste management.

Key Benefits in Recycling:

  • Crushes concrete, bricks, and asphalt into reusable base material
  • Reduces landfill waste while supporting sustainable practices
  • Can be mobile, enabling on-site processing
Recycled Material End Use Jaw Crusher Function
Concrete rubble Recycled road base, fill material Turns bulk into usable gravel
Brick and masonry Backfill or aggregate substitute Size reduction and clean fill
Asphalt Reclaimed asphalt pavement (RAP) Prepares for remixing or reuse

In modern construction, jaw crushers help close the loop between demolition and reuse.
